While this bill is a start there is still no language to address Any policy on cancer care in the VA. There are over 15,000 cases of prostate cancer diagnoses each year and the VA has no consistent policy in how to address this issue. The VA also does not have the most current technology to deal with this condition and it needs to support the outsourcing of specialized care. Any cancer patient should be given all the same access to care as private industry. We also need to be screening veterans for prostate cancer each year starting at age 40.
